Dollar Tree Recalls Glue Guns


June 24, 2008
Dollar Tree is recalling about 470,000 Crafters Square Hot Melt mini glue guns. The recalled glue guns can short circuit, causing the gun to smoke. This poses a fire hazard to consumers.

Dollar Tree is aware of four incidents in which these glue guns short circuited. No injuries have been reported.

This recall involves the 'Crafters Square Hot Melt Mini Glue Gun' with product number '939701'. The gun dispenses hot glue and is intended for craft projects. The glue gun is black with an orange trigger and measures approximately 4 1/2 inches from the back of the gun to the tip. It has a 44-inch electrical cord attached. 'Crafters Square' and '939701' are located on the guns' packaging. 'DS-010 Glue Gun' is written in raised letters on the handle of the gun.

The glue guns, made in China, were sold at Dollar Tree, Dollar Bill$, Dollar Express, Greenbacks, Only One $1, and Deal$ stores nationwide from December 2007 through March 2008 for about $1.

Consumers should immediately stop using the recalled glue guns and return them to the store where purchased for a full refund.

Consumer Contact: For additional information, contact Dollar Tree Stores at (800) 876-8077 between 9 a.m. and 5 p.m. ET Monday through Friday, or visit the firm's Web site at www.dollartree.com.

The recall is being conducted in cooperation with the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C).
